TakeMySpred - любой спред, даже отрицательный !!!

 

Приветствую

Про подмену спреда в symbols.sel вы уже наверно знаете.

Я просто решил облегчить этот процесс, надоело вручную в хекс редакторе править.


Для тех кто этого раньше не делал.

Изменить спред можно только перед запуском терминала.

Связи с брокером быть не должно. Либо отключаем интернет, либо забиваем несуществующий прокси в терминале (например: 127.0.0.1:80) ставим галочку "Разрешить прокси" и закрываем терминал.

Далее запускаем энту ацкую прогу и указываем путь к файлу Symbols.sel (например: C:\Program Files\MetaTrader - Alpari\history\Alpari-Micro2\). Отыскиваем в списке нужный инструмент, вписываем в текстбокс нужный спред и жмем "Писать". Что там записалось можно узнать если нажать "Читать". Всё прога больше не нужна, закрываем. При закрытии она попутно создаст ini файл и в след. раз путь к папке указывать не надо. Спред задаётся в стандартных пунктах, т.е. если инструмент имеет 5 знаков пунктом считаеться 4-ый, если 3 то 2-ой. Вроде всё.

Файлы:
 

И зачем это?

 
api писал(а) >>

И зачем это?

Чтобы лопухи могли себе подобным стейты впаривать. Не иначе...

 
MaStak >>:

Приветствую

Про подмену спреда в symbols.sel вы уже наверно знаете.

Я просто решил облегчить этот процесс, надоело вручную в хекс редакторе править.


Для тех кто этого раньше не делал.

Изменить спред можно только перед запуском терминала.

Связи с брокером быть не должно. Либо отключаем интернет, либо забиваем несуществующий прокси в терминале (например: 127.0.0.1:80) ставим галочку "Разрешить прокси" и закрываем терминал.

Далее запускаем энту ацкую прогу и указываем путь к файлу Symbols.sel (например: C:\Program Files\MetaTrader - Alpari\history\Alpari-Micro2\). Отыскиваем в списке нужный инструмент, вписываем в текстбокс нужный спред и жмем "Писать". Что там записалось можно узнать если нажать "Читать". Всё прога больше не нужна, закрываем. При закрытии она попутно создаст ini файл и в след. раз путь к папке указывать не надо. Спред задаётся в стандартных пунктах, т.е. если инструмент имеет 5 знаков пунктом считаеться 4-ый, если 3 то 2-ой. Вроде всё.


Ерунда какая-то

 
Штука полезная. Позволяет отделить мух от котлет и протестировать систему на нетральных условиях. Слышал Ким в свое время продавал подобную приблуду, аж за 100 баксов. А Вы говорите ерунда.
 
MaStak огромное спасибо за эту оч нужную штуковину! И нужна она не для разводов! к примеру нужно тестануть советник на разных спредах, такого параметра в мт нет, у каждого брокера свой спред, и что теперь качать терминал каждого брокера?гг, ..а так можно без хлопот проверить устойчивость своего грааля
 

Mastak - молодчага! Хотел сам писать нечто подобное, а тут уже все почти готово!!!

Пожелания: 1) Сделать универсальный выбор пути файла, т.е. что бы был выбор диска. Можно конечно править руками tms.ini, но это как-то не по взрослому....

2) Для пятизнака может переключатель-чекбоксик сделать? А то спред получается напр., = 2,3 ну не эстетично....

3) ИМХО. Очень необходимо чтение/запись значений свопов длинных/коротких. Для более полной идентичности тестирования.

4) В названии Spred заменить на Spread. Ну что бы вообще было всё красиво.

А вообще - низкий поклон. Спасибо.

 

Можете поделиться форматом файла? Можно просто куском кода, который делает основную задачу, если лень расписывать. Спасибо в любом случае.


Для тех, кто в танке,зачем эта программа - оставайтесь там :)

 
alvish >>:
... к примеру нужно тестануть советник на разных спредах, такого параметра в мт нет, у каждого брокера свой спред, и что теперь качать терминал каждого брокера?гг, ..а так можно без хлопот проверить устойчивость своего грааля

Без хлопот в терминал вбивается IP:порт нужного дилинга,

подкачиваем нужную историю, и тестим на устойчивость грааль...

:)))

 
MaStak >>:

Приветствую

Про подмену спреда в symbols.sel вы уже наверно знаете.

Я просто решил облегчить этот процесс, надоело вручную в хекс редакторе править.


Для тех кто этого раньше не делал.

Изменить спред можно только перед запуском терминала.

Связи с брокером быть не должно. Либо отключаем интернет, либо забиваем несуществующий прокси в терминале (например: 127.0.0.1:80) ставим галочку "Разрешить прокси" и закрываем терминал.

Далее запускаем энту ацкую прогу и указываем путь к файлу Symbols.sel (например: C:\Program Files\MetaTrader - Alpari\history\Alpari-Micro2\). Отыскиваем в списке нужный инструмент, вписываем в текстбокс нужный спред и жмем "Писать". Что там записалось можно узнать если нажать "Читать". Всё прога больше не нужна, закрываем. При закрытии она попутно создаст ini файл и в след. раз путь к папке указывать не надо. Спред задаётся в стандартных пунктах, т.е. если инструмент имеет 5 знаков пунктом считаеться 4-ый, если 3 то 2-ой. Вроде всё.


спасибо, какраз кстати)))

 
afx000 >>:

Можете поделиться форматом файла? Можно просто куском кода, который делает основную задачу, если лень расписывать. Спасибо в любом случае.


Для тех, кто в танке,зачем эта программа - оставайтесь там :)

Вобщето, ищите и обрящите.

Подождите след. версии, возможно Вам и не понадобится формат.

Причина обращения: